We're 100 years young and we need you!!Job summaryThe Warehouse Associate has a key role in ensuring that products are received, verified, stored, and transported to the sales floor or in the warehouse in a safe and efficient manner. This role involves constant handling of merchandise that varies in weight from light to heavy throughout the shift.

Responsibilities:

  • Receive, scan, verify and store all incoming products.
  • Store overstock.
  • Ship returns, process damaged claims and complete paperwork.
  • Ensure inventory accuracy.
  • Dispose garbage and cardboard.
  • Operate all warehouse equipment safely.
  • Ensure compliance with Health and Safety regulations.

Requirements / Skills

  • No experience is required!!! – We will provide all the training you need!
  • Ability to handle physical demands including standing/walking for 8 hours while frequently lifting and carrying items, using a ladder, twisting, turning and reaching
  • Ability to work shifts (days, evenings, week-ends and holidays)
  • Strong computer skills
  • Ability to find solutions to problems, adapt and cope with challenging situations and make decisions
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and to multitask
  • Certification in forklift and/or skyjack (scissor lift) (asset)
